Hi I just got an angelfish a week ago, I had 5 mollies but 3 of them were bullying the angel fish so I took them back to petstore, but now I’ve noticed this white film, like very very fine white dots that almost look like he has bubbles on him, or like a fuzzy appearance, I don’t think it’s ich since I’ve had to deal with that before but I’m thinking maybe velvet? But none of the pics I look up look like it, he’s also showing no symptoms and seems happy, no flicking against objects and is swimming fine, my 2 mollies don’t have the dots at all does anyone know what this is?(also the big white dots in the pictures look like they’re on him but they’re not, just bubbles :))

tank parameters pH 7.0, nitrites 0 nitrates 40 ammonia 0, gh 60 and kh 80, tank has been cycling for 3 months before adding fish, tank is 20 gal tall but planning on upgrading when angelfish gets bigger, temp is 81

From the photos it looks like your angelfish is stressed, this will make it susceptible to a wide range of diseases, fungus being the main cause if the fish has lost scales and has wounds. You could try a teaspoon of aquarium salt to 5 litres of water, it should help if not try using waterlife white spot and fungus treatment as well. I have used them both together and have had good results. I hope this will help to resolve the problem.
